If you are anything like me, you are looking forward to the holiday weekend! The weather is going to be great and we can take a few minutes away from our offices and busy schedules and spend time with our friends and family. More importantly, we will be celebrating Memorial Day.
Nearly 35 years ago, when I was serving in the military, it seemed as though there were many who were somewhat ambivalent towards our nation's service men and women. Today, however, things have dramatically changed. Our nation proudly salutes its heroes who bravely go out to fight for us every day.
Yet, so often, we become caught up in our day-to-day routines and we forget to take time and thank the people that matter. We fall short thanking our friends, our family, and our loved ones for the important roles they play in our lives. Time and again, we end up losing our patience over small imperfections and minor dilemmas. Subsequently, we stop thinking about the fact that there are people who have risked or lost their lives for our country. We fail to remember those who have worked hard to make a difference in our world.
This weekend, let's not forget to truly take time out and honor the people who deserve so much praise! Take some time to thank those Men and Women who have served, and continue to serve, and never forget those who have so bravely lost their lives for our freedom.
